Hi, On 2015-12-29 11:22:52 +0000, amul sul wrote: > Uninitialized variable 'dtype' warning in date_in() is fix[1] on branch 9.3 & > above, but not for 9.2 & older branches. I guess this should be back-patch. > [1] commit link=> > http://git.postgresql.org/pg/commitdiff/5c45d2f87835ccd3ffac338845ec79cab1b31a11
We don't routinely backpatch warnings. Often enough the benefit is not worth the risk. In this case I'd possibly gone the other way, but given it's a low frequency warning in old branches I'm not inclined to do so today.
